Transaction 058eba7069036a363792f04467f2491c368b3431ab74d838fe9fedc657118c85

1 Input
2 Outputs
  • 058eba7069036a363792f04467f2491c368b3431ab74d838fe9fedc657118c85:0
  • value  1895747
    address  32BivfoNz3Ne8i7GNBH8AJNZcsbn53sh8F
  • 058eba7069036a363792f04467f2491c368b3431ab74d838fe9fedc657118c85:1
  • value  15291988
    address  38Hcq1Da8YjJUJux8K5JvrL2ZXHxZGSdKA